Output 51f31fd842c57924ce0444f301d9bb10fb16cd9ae1770f303add607a36898107:0

value
10604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35e5cb98d287fb5c184e18b1fa233da800ead666 OP_EQUALVERIFY OP_CHECKSIG
address
15uz6dDX75LwbECScMaAKoVYmmwyMbRwHd
transaction
51f31fd842c57924ce0444f301d9bb10fb16cd9ae1770f303add607a36898107
spent
true